1927600

Confess Your Sins

Specimen

Specimen is a Music Video by Confess Your Sins.

Status: Released
Studio: Degenerate Productions
Producer: S. Engels
Production Cost: 10,000.00 M$
Release Date: 4/3/2014
Review: earth shaking

Video Shoot Details

Scene Name: Specimen
Scene Status: Finished
Soundtrack: Specimen
Type of Scene: Song & Dance Number
Location: 新宿御苑/Shinjuku Gyoen, Tokyo
Filming: 3/27/2014, 6:00 AM
Role Cast & Crew Performance
Actor S. Engels 40
Actor Z. Engels 40
Director Z. Engels 50
Actor P. Connelly 40